This chapter reviews the research and clinical features of intensive therapeutic lifestyle change treatment (ITLC). ITLC can produce dramatic treatment effects in hours or days, such as improved cardiac perfusion and increased insulin sensitivity. Oatmeal has soluble fiber, which reduces your low-density lipoprotein (LDL) cholesterol, the "bad" cholesterol. Soluble fiber is also found in such foods as kidney beans, Brussels sprouts, apples and pears.
